Job summary
A city government in Oklahoma is seeking a Construction Inspector I to oversee engineering construction inspections ensuring compliance with specifications and city codes. This role requires an Associate's Degree or a trade school certificate, along with a minimum of 18 months of experience in public works or related fields. A valid Oklahoma driver's license is needed, and certifications must be obtained within one year of hire. The position offers a starting salary of $26.4537 - $28.0102 per hour with benefits.
